I.E. Bids Richard Tolbert Farewell

Invincible Eleven (IE) Majestic Sports Association outgoing President, Dr. Richard Tolbert, urged players of the club to always do their best in national leagues.

Speaking over the weekend during a farewell lunch held in his honor at the Airfield Entertainment Center in Sinkor, Monrovia, after three years of service, Dr. Tolbert told the players that it was time for him to quit the leadership because he has played his part and was now time to give way to a new leadership.

Responding on behalf of fellow players, I.E. Captain, Segbe Peter, commended Dr. Tolbert for his tenure of service and assured him that they will never forget the responsible manner in which he led the club.

“We as players owe you, Dr. Tolbert, a debt of gratitude and we have begun to feel your absence because you were always with us during difficult and good times; we will miss you”, said Segbe.

It can be recalled that under Dr. Tolbert’s leadership, I.E. won the Golden Image Award and sent two players abroad, Herron Berrian and Dweh Allison, for professional soccer. Allison went to Palmieres to Brazil while Berrian landed in Free State All Stars in South Africa, but now plays in Greece.

Meanwhile, Dr. Tolbert has thanked fans, players, technical staff and Board members of I.E. for their support to the “Sunshine Yellow Boys.”
